I am a PhD student in the Department of Computer Science and Engineering at the Indian Institute of Technology, Madras, advised by Prof. Manikandan Narayanan in the Bioinformatics and Integrative Data Science (BIRDS) Lab. I am a former Prime Minister’s Research Fellow (PMRF).

My research focuses on developing machine learning and signal processing frameworks for genomic sequence analysis, with applications in species classification and antimicrobial resistance (AMR) prediction — particularly in Mycobacterium tuberculosis. I design scalable, data-driven models that learn directly from raw genomic sequences, capturing both local and global patterns without heavy reliance on prior biological assumptions.

MIC Prediction using Genomic Data of M. tuberculosis

Developing machine learning models to predict minimum inhibitory concentrations (MICs) from whole-genome sequencing data, enabling fine-grained antimicrobial resistance profiling for Mycobacterium tuberculosis.

Benchmarking AMR Prediction for Second-line Drugs in M. tuberculosis

Establishing a comprehensive benchmark of machine and deep learning models for predicting resistance to second-line anti-TB drugs using whole-genome sequencing data.

Genomic Signal Processing for Species Classification

Developed SpecGMM, a framework integrating spectral analysis and Gaussian Mixture Models for DNA-based taxonomic classification and identification of discriminative DNA regions. Published in Bioinformatics Advances.
